U盘移动Steam游戏怎么玩?我的实战经验全分享

这一切始于一次尴尬的聚会

那天我带着我的小U盘去朋友家,准备展示我苦练两个月的《只狼》速通。结果U盘插上去,Steam库死活刷不出游戏,就在那转圈。朋友调侃说“你的游戏在U盘里旅游呢?”,我表面笑嘻嘻内心崩溃。回来我下定决心,必须搞明白怎么让U盘里的Steam游戏在任何电脑上都能直接玩。经过一周的摸索,我总结了一套非常稳妥的办法,现在我的U盘就是我的移动游戏库。

硬件是基础:我选固态U盘的几个标准

我用过几种U盘,普通闪存盘跑游戏卡得让人绝望,加载时间比游戏时间还长。后来我换成了闪迪CZ880,读写400MB/s以上,这才基本流畅。容量我选512G,能装下三四个3A大作。格式一定要用NTFS或者exFAT,千万不能用FAT32,不然《赛博朋克2077》的4K材质文件拷不进去。我把我的U盘命名为“游戏棒”,专门为游戏准备。

移动游戏,官方工具最省心

最初我傻傻地直接复制游戏文件夹,结果放到另一台电脑上Steam根本不认。后来我发现Steam内置了完美的库迁移功能。通过设置里的下载页面,添加库文件夹指定到U盘目录,然后在游戏上右键选择移动安装文件夹,选U盘库位置,Steam就会完整迁移并验证文件。这个方法我试了好几个游戏,《博德之门3》《艾尔登法环》都一次成功,迁移后还能保证所有DLC和更新文件完整。对了,移动前我会关掉Steam的自动更新以及退出后台,这样避免文件占用失败。

移动后的检查工作

迁完后,我会在U盘的Steam库文件夹里查看steamapps\appmanifest_xxx.acf文件,这个文件记录了游戏的信息,它必须和游戏本体对应。如果在另一台电脑上Steam扫描不到游戏,常见原因就是库文件夹路径不对或者这个acf文件缺失。有次我误删了acf文件,结果折腾半天重新扫描。

U盘移动Steam游戏怎么玩?我的实战经验全分享

在陌生电脑上流畅运行的秘诀

到了朋友家,插上U盘,打开Steam登录我自己的账号。第一次需要在设置中添加U盘上的库文件夹,然后游戏库就会显示已安装。但我发现直接开玩可能会出现各种缺少运行库的报错。这时候我一般会先去游戏目录下的_CommonRedist文件夹,把vcredist、DirectX、NET Framework都装一遍。这个是很多玩家容易忽略的点。所以我提前在U盘根目录放了一个“运行库包”,包含各种常见VC++和DX9/11/12,需要时直接装,省得从网上下载。另外要注意的是,有些游戏比如《地平线:零之曙光》对外置存储兼容不好,会随机闪退,换成固态U盘后改善有限,这类游戏我干脆就不放进U盘了。

注意云存档与本地存档冲突

我在玩《文明6》时发现,家里的云存档和朋友的电脑存档版本不同步,差点毁掉我200回合的大好局面。所以每次启动前我都确认一下Steam云存档同步状态。对于云存档支持不好的老游戏,我会手动从本机存档位置复制存档到U盘的备份目录里,再还原到新电脑上。这样即使云存档出问题也不慌。

那些让人抓狂的坑

我遇到过最坑的一次是在移动《巫师3》时,U盘写入突然中断,再插上Steam说文件损坏,我只好删除重移,白白浪费一个小时。所以现在移动大游戏我都会保证U盘供电稳定(插在主机后置接口),并且过程中不碰U盘。还有就是《绝地求生》这类频繁加载的游戏,在U盘上玩虽然能运行,但跳伞瞬间偶尔会画面卡顿,这是USB延迟导致的,换用USB 3.2 Gen2×2接口后有所好转,但还是不如内置固态。外接游戏总有点牺牲,但为了便携我认了。

我现在的日常使用

现在我的512GB固态U盘常驻三款游戏:《黑帝斯》《文明6》和《博德之门3》。前两个加载快对U盘依赖低,第三个虽大但运行稳定。去外地工作或者回老家,只带U盘和一台轻薄本,插上就能找回熟悉的大屏体验。每当在陌生的地方看到熟悉的游戏加载界面,我都会觉得自己当时的探索真值得。游戏嘛,本来就该随时享受,不是吗?